Common Wood Windows Installation Jobs
Wood window installation involves fitting new or replacement wooden windows to enhance home aesthetics and energy efficiency.
Custom wood window projects include designing and installing windows tailored to specific architectural styles.
Historic home window upgrades focus on preserving original wood features while improving performance.
Energy-efficient wood window replacements help reduce heating and cooling costs with modern insulating materials.
Bay and bow window installations add architectural interest and natural light to living spaces.
Storm window additions provide extra protection and insulation for wood-framed windows in harsh weather.
Wood Windows Installation Questions
What types of wood windows are available for installation? There are various styles including double-hung, casement, and picture windows, suitable for different aesthetic and functional needs.
How do I know if my property is ready for wood window installation? The existing window openings should be structurally sound and properly prepared to ensure a smooth installation process.
What are common reasons to replace wood windows? Replacement is often considered for improved energy efficiency, increased curb appeal, or to restore older, damaged windows.
What should property owners consider before choosing wood windows? Consider the style of the property, maintenance requirements, and the desired level of insulation and durability.
